UMass Boston Issues Alert After Reports Of Gunfire On Campus

Last night, UMass Boston issued a safety alert after unconfirmed reports of gunfire on campus. The university advised students and staff to shelter in place while public safety officers investigated the situation.

The reported incident, alleged to have occurred in or near the Residence Hall East Building, prompted a swift response from the university's Department of Public Safety, who collaborated with local law enforcement to ensure the safety of the campus community. Students and staff were advised to avoid the area and keep doors closed and locked until the situation was resolved.

The campus community was notified of the all-clear via the UMass Boston emergency alert system, with the specific warning regarding the threat coming from the university's Department of Public Safety.
